Which neurons are involved in parkinsonism?
Correct Answer: C
Rationale: Parkinsonism is primarily characterized by the degeneration of dopaminergic neurons in the substantia nigra, leading to reduced dopamine levels in the basal ganglia. While cholinergic and GABAergic neurons play roles in basal ganglia circuitry, the core pathology of Parkinsonism centers on dopaminergic neuron loss, making 'Dopaminergic neurons' the correct choice.
